Vision inspection systems represent the most sophisticated layer of quality monitoring available on modern box folding equipment, employing high-resolution cameras and specialized lighting to detect defects that escape traditional mechanical or photoelectric sensors. These systems capture images of each box at strategic points along the production path, typically after the folding section and before the final delivery, comparing the captured image against a stored reference template using advanced pattern recognition algorithms. The technology identifies dimensional deviations, panel misalignments, incomplete folds, and adhesive application errors with accuracy exceeding 0.1 millimeter, far surpassing the capabilities of manual visual inspection conducted under production pressures. Photoelectric sensors and laser-based detection devices provide continuous monitoring of sheet presence, position, and speed throughout the folding process, offering real-time feedback that enables automatic adjustments to maintain alignment and synchronization. These sensors, positioned at the feeder, fold plates, and glue applicator, verify that the sheet arrives at each station at the correct timing and orientation, alerting the control system to any deviation that might cause a jam or quality defect. The sensors also monitor glue application, detecting adhesive presence and pattern accuracy to ensure that each panel receives the correct quantity of adhesive at the right location. When combined with the vision inspection system, these sensors create a comprehensive monitoring network that leaves virtually no defect undetected. Quality inspection systems on advanced box folders extend beyond defect detection to encompass production data collection and analysis, enabling manufacturers to achieve consistent quality across extended production runs. The sensors capture dimensional measurements, alignment values, and adhesive coverage data for each box, storing this information in a production database that tracks quality trends over time. This data enables root cause analysis when defects occur, identifying whether issues stem from material variations, temperature changes, or mechanical wear, and facilitating proactive adjustments that reduce reject rates. The information also supports compliance requirements for industries requiring batch traceability, such as pharmaceuticals and food packaging, where verification of production conditions becomes a regulatory requirement. The integration of smart sensors and inspection systems also extends to the glue application station, where closed-loop controls maintain adhesive flow and pattern consistency independent of fluctuations in viscosity, temperature, or production speed. These systems incorporate pressure sensors and flow meters that communicate with a central controller, adjusting pump speed and nozzle position to maintain the specified adhesive pattern across varying production conditions. When combined with the vision inspection system's ability to verify adhesive presence and position on finished boxes, these controls create a redundant monitoring network that virtually eliminates the possibility of adhesive-related defects reaching customers. This reliability proves particularly valuable for operations producing complex carton configurations such as crash-lock-bottom or four-corner boxes, where proper adhesive placement is critical to package integrity.
